Output 873915948d671ebfe93fe01393319a63e13dda78c57c6bf35a604fc9eeb5a17a:7

value
520543
script pubkey
OP_0 OP_PUSHBYTES_20 8ac1b52b586498d2793413e91792d68196f0d350
address
bc1q3tqm226cvjvdy7f5z0530ykksxt0p56se2xcvq
transaction
873915948d671ebfe93fe01393319a63e13dda78c57c6bf35a604fc9eeb5a17a
spent
true